Commander Resources reports developments as a Canada-based copper-gold mineral explorer with a portfolio that includes porphyry copper-gold projects, a high-grade copper-gold VMS project, and a carried interest in a copper-gold project. Company updates commonly address the 100% owned Burn Copper and Gold porphyry property in British Columbia, including ownership interests, royalties, geophysical surveys, drilling interpretations, and target generation.
Recurring disclosures also include material agreements, capital-structure matters, shareholder voting and governance topics, early-warning ownership reports, operating and financial results, and responses to corporate actions such as unsolicited takeover activity.
The Special Committee of Commander Resources has confirmed that FruchtExpress Grabher GmbH & Co KG (FEx) has made an unsolicited cash offer to acquire all outstanding shares of Commander not already owned by FEx at $0.09 per share. This offer, originally proposed on March 4, 2024, was formally communicated to Commander's Special Committee on May 23, 2024. Shareholders are advised to take no action until the Board of Directors, upon recommendations from the Special Committee, provides a formal response. The Special Committee, led by David Watkins, with members Eric Norton and Brandon Macdonald, is currently evaluating the offer and exploring potential alternatives. Results of these assessments will be communicated shortly. Commander emphasizes that there is no certainty the Special Committee or Board will support FEx's offer.
